Where was the first place math was found?
Flauer [41]

Answer:

Mesopotamia

Step-by-step explanation:

The oldest clay tablets with mathematics date back over 4,000 years ago in Mesopotamia. The oldest written texts on mathematics are Egyptian papyruses.
